The Role of Deep Learning in Real-Time Video Analytics

The Role of Deep Learning in Real-Time Video Analytics

Deep learning has emerged as a groundbreaking technology in various fields, and its impact on real-time video analytics is particularly noteworthy. With the exponential growth of video data generated daily, leveraging deep learning algorithms has become crucial for extracting meaningful insights from this data in real-time.

One of the key advantages of deep learning in video analytics is its ability to perform complex pattern recognition tasks. With convolutional neural networks (CNNs) at the forefront, deep learning models can analyze individual frames of video to identify objects, activities, and even specific behaviors. This capability is essential in applications such as security surveillance, traffic monitoring, and retail analytics, where timely and accurate information is critical for decision-making.

In security, for instance, deep learning algorithms can enhance facial recognition systems, allowing them to identify individuals in crowded environments quickly. By processing video feeds in real-time, these systems can alert security personnel to potential threats, significantly improving response times and overall safety.

Moreover, deep learning helps in motion detection and tracking. Advanced algorithms can differentiate between typical movements and suspicious behavior, enabling automated systems to flag anomalies. This feature is increasingly valuable in smart city initiatives, where monitoring traffic flow and pedestrian safety can lead to improved urban planning and accident prevention.

Retailers are also harnessing the power of deep learning for video analytics. By analyzing customer behaviors in-store, businesses can optimize product placements, monitor crowd density, and enhance the overall shopping experience. Real-time video data can provide insights into customer preferences, helping retailers tailor their marketing strategies effectively.

Another significant application of deep learning in video analytics is in healthcare. Real-time video surveillance can monitor patients in critical care, utilizing deep learning algorithms to detect changes in behavior or health indicators, thus enabling prompt medical intervention if necessary.

The combination of deep learning and edge computing further amplifies the potential of real-time video analytics. By processing data closer to the source, edge computing reduces latency and bandwidth usage, allowing for instantaneous analysis and quicker response times. This synergy is proving beneficial in various sectors, from industrial automation to autonomous vehicles.

Despite its many advantages, implementing deep learning for real-time video analytics comes with challenges. High computational requirements and the need for large labeled datasets can hinder deployment. However, advancements in hardware and the development of pre-trained models are gradually overcoming these barriers, making deep learning more accessible for a broader range of applications.

In conclusion, deep learning is transforming real-time video analytics, enabling more intelligent and efficient systems across multiple industries. With its ability to recognize patterns, detect anomalies, and provide actionable insights almost instantaneously, deep learning continues to pave the way for innovative solutions that enhance security, improve customer experiences, and foster smarter cities.